GeneralCalling a "Final" routine when application is ended by machine closing. Pin
HollenG22-Nov-04 7:32
HollenG22-Nov-04 7:32 
Confused | :confused: Does anyone know if you can have a routine run when your VB.NET or C# application is shut-down from the "Task Manager" or when the user shuts down their machine before they have closed your application? In other words is there a spot in a .NET application that runs no matter how the application is closed? I tried the "Closing" method of the "Default" form which I believe is the last thing to close when a C# or VB.NET appliation ends. My app has a "logon" status flag that I'd like to be able to reset for the user if they forget to close the app the normal way and just exit the machine from the "Start" menu with my application still running.
